What Is Vitamin E?

Vitamin E is, as you’ve probably guessed, a vitamin. Specifically, it’s a fat-soluble vitamin. This means it’s best absorbed by the body when fat or oil is present.

It literally dissolves in “fat.” This is convenient because fat-rich products like vegetable oils, nuts, and seeds contain relatively high amounts of Vitamin E. Our body doesn’t produce Vitamin E itself, so you can only get it through your diet.

The most active component in Vitamin E is α-tocopherol, which is why it’s also called “tocopherol.” Under this name, you’ll see Vitamin E listed in the ingredients of skincare products.

→ Did you know that Vitamin E is the most common vitamin in your skin? Yes, that’s right. Especially the skin layer with dead skin cells contains relatively high amounts of Vitamin E. The vitamin reaches the sebaceous glands through the body, and then into the upper skin layer.

Where Is Vitamin E Found?

As I mentioned, our body doesn’t produce Vitamin E, so we need to get it from our diet.

Of course, you can also take Vitamin E supplements, but Vitamin E deficiency is rare in the Netherlands, so supplementation is often unnecessary. You can get all the Vitamin E you need from your food. Specifically, plant oils and plant-based products are incredibly rich in Vitamin E.

Here are some examples:

  • Leafy vegetables
  • Sunflower oil
  • Nuts
  • Seeds
  • Grains

Animal products contain relatively little Vitamin E.

How Much Vitamin E Do You Need Daily?

Women generally need less Vitamin E than men.

The recommended daily intake for women over 18 is 11 milligrams of Vitamin E from food. For adult men over 18, it’s 13 milligrams per day.

If you eat a healthy and varied diet, you can assume you’re getting enough Vitamin E. Supplements are unnecessary in most cases.

Make sure to regularly eat plant oils, nuts, seeds, vegetables, and grains. These are excellent sources of Vitamin E.

Suspecting a Vitamin E Deficiency?

If your diet isn’t great or if you’re dealing with low immunity or illness, you might wonder if you have a Vitamin E deficiency.

A deficiency occurs when you consistently don’t meet the recommended daily intake of Vitamin E. Fortunately, a (severe) Vitamin E deficiency is very rare.

If you suspect a deficiency, it’s best to consult your doctor or a dietitian. They can do a blood test to check if you’re getting enough vitamins and minerals.
